Question:

(i) Write the electronic configuration of the following ions: (a) Cr3+ (b) Cu2+.
(ii) Write the formula of chromate and dichromate ions.

Solution and Explanation

Step 1: Rule for writing ion configurations. First write the configuration of the neutral atom, then remove electrons for a cation. For d-block ions, electrons are removed from the outer 4s orbital first and then from 3d.
Step 2: Cr3+ (Z = 24). Neutral chromium: [Ar] 3d5 4s1. Removing 3 electrons (first the 4s electron, then two 3d electrons) gives:
Cr3+: [Ar] 3d3, i.e. 1s2 2s2 2p6 3s2 3p6 3d3.
Step 3: Cu2+ (Z = 29). Neutral copper: [Ar] 3d10 4s1. Removing 2 electrons (first 4s, then one 3d) gives:
Cu2+: [Ar] 3d9, i.e. 1s2 2s2 2p6 3s2 3p6 3d9.
Step 4: Formulae of the ions.
Chromate ion: CrO42−
Dichromate ion: Cr2O72−
